What Is Giclée Printing?

Preserving the atmosphere of the original artwork for years to come.

When choosing an art print, it's not only the design or color that matters. The printing method plays an equally important role in how the artwork is experienced.

At [Rom.] Creative Studio, we use Giclée printing to faithfully reproduce the delicate lines, subtle color variations, and rich texture of each original artwork.

Giclée printing is a high-resolution inkjet printing process widely used for fine art reproductions and museum-quality photographic prints. Compared with conventional poster printing, it offers smoother tonal gradations, greater color accuracy, and exceptional detail—capturing everything from the finest brushstrokes and soft washes of color to the quiet beauty of negative space.

For example, the finest pencil lines, the gentle tonal transitions of watercolor, and the subtle textures that only hand-painted artwork can create.

By faithfully preserving these delicate details, each print retains the depth, atmosphere, and presence of the original artwork—offering an experience that goes far beyond an ordinary poster.
